World Music and Arts events raise money to improve children’s health and education in The Gambia.
One of our members of staff has been sponsoring a little girl, Lisa, in The Gambia for a number of years. After visiting Lisa and her school with a friend, they were determined to do more to improve children’s health and education there.
They got together with a few friends to put on a festival in West Sussex. In addition to raising money for the school and local health clinic, they wanted to promote multi-cultural awareness and bring to their home town a variety of world music and arts.
And so the community group “Nyodema” (which means “Helping Each Other” in Mandinka, one of The Gambia’s tribal languages) was born.
The festival has become an annual event and Nyodema now also runs weekly West African Drumming workshops and a community choir.
